Guns N' Roses kick off tour with explosive show
Sydney Morning Herald - 5 minutes ago
It would be so easy to write-off Guns N' Roses and slam their Perth Arena show that kicked off their Australian tour.
Many of their fans often do just that when they argue the band can't be considered the same group anymore as only one member still remains from the original hit-making line-up.
While infamous tales of delayed performances and hostile attitude towards the audience don't exactly sell tickets.
But Saturday night in Perth, Axl Rose and his band steadily eased fears of a potential GN'R catastrophe with what was essentially ? and surprisingly for this reviewer - a great rock show.
Blasting out an array of hits from the band's incredible debut Appetite For Destruction to tracks from the last album 2008's Chinese Democracy, the output was one that brought the best out from their musicians ; especially the trio of lead guitarists.
Welcome To The Jungle, Sweet Child O' Mine and Patience were all there and well received even if at times it was hard to hear Rose's vocals over the cheering crowd.
But an explosive cover of Live And Let Die and an extensive Knockin' On Heaven's Door were highlights of the night.
But the quality of the music can't be denied, and the level of Rose's vocals aside - which faded at times only to come back near perfectly later ? the band sounded great.
Rose particularly impressed when they wheeled out the piano for him on November Rain.
